Introducing Bridal bouquet to Your Garden

Visual Impact of Bridal bouquet in Landscaping

The first impression of any garden is often dictated by its visual appeal, and Bridal bouquet is a showstopper in this regard. With its lush green leaves and pristine white flowers, it can serve as an eye-catching centerpiece. The flowers, resembling a bridal bouquet, bring a romantic and elegant touch, instantly elevating the aesthetic value of your landscape. Whether planted solo or in clusters, the distinct and vibrant appearance of Bridal bouquet will surely captivate anyone who gazes upon your garden.

Choosing the Ideal Location for Bridal bouquet

Location is key when planting Bridal bouquet to ensure it thrives and enhances your garden's overall look. Bridal bouquet prefers full sun to partial shade, so select a spot that gets ample sunlight. It's also essential to consider the spacing; Bridal bouquet can grow quite large, so ensure there’s enough room for it to spread its branches without obstructing other plants. Planting near paths or entryways can frame these areas beautifully, inviting guests and creating a welcoming environment.

Complementing Bridal bouquet with Other Plants

Bridal bouquet pairs well with various other plants, making it versatile for numerous garden styles. For a tropical look, combine it with other exotic plants like hibiscus or bird of paradise. If you prefer a more subdued garden, it looks equally stunning alongside evergreens or ornamental grasses. The white blooms of Bridal bouquet offer a neutral contrast, allowing you to play creatively with colors and textures without clashing.

Seasonal Considerations for Bridal bouquet

Best Times of Year to Plant Bridal bouquet

Timing is crucial for planting Bridal bouquet. The ideal seasons are late spring to early summer, as the warmer weather promotes better root establishment and growth. Avoid planting during the colder months or in areas prone to frost, as Bridal bouquet prefers warm temperatures and may struggle to thrive in adverse conditions.

Weather Conditions Favorable for Bridal bouquet

Bridal bouquet flourishes in warm climates, so it's essential to plant it in conditions where it can receive plenty of sun while being protected from harsh winds. While it can tolerate some dry periods, consistent watering will help it reach its full potential. In regions with a cooler climate, consider planting Bridal bouquet in a pot, so it can be moved indoors if the temperature drops too much.

Design Tips: Utilizing Bridal bouquet Effectively

Creating Focal Points with Bridal bouquet

To create a stunning focal point in your garden, plant Bridal bouquet where it can draw the eye naturally, such as at the end of a walkway or in the center of a flower bed. Its bright and beautiful flowers can break up monotonous green spaces, providing striking visual interest and a touch of brilliance.

Balancing Aesthetics and Maintenance

While Bridal bouquet is undoubtedly beautiful, it’s important to balance its aesthetic value with practical maintenance considerations. Regular pruning will maintain its shape and encourage more blooms, while ensuring sufficient space for air circulation can prevent common plant diseases. Fertilizing it during the growing season can also boost flower production and overall health.

Using Bridal bouquet in Thematic Gardens

Whether you’re aiming for a tropical paradise or a serene and elegant garden, Bridal bouquet can fit seamlessly into various themes. For a tropical theme, pair it with brightly colored flowers and lush greenery. For a more minimalist and elegant garden, combine it with plants that have simpler foliage and neutral tones, accentuating Bridal bouquet as the standout element.

Long-Term Growth and Care

Anticipating the Growth of Bridal bouquet

Understanding the growth pattern of Bridal bouquet is essential for long-term garden planning. It can grow several feet high and wide, so allow it ample space to reach its full size without overcrowding. Regular pruning helps control its size and encourages healthier, denser growth, ensuring that it remains a stunning feature in your garden for years.

Preparing for Seasonal Changes

As the seasons change, so too do the needs of your garden. In autumn, start adjusting watering routines and reduce fertilization as Bridal bouquet prepares for a dormant period. If you live in an area prone to frost, protect Bridal bouquet by covering it or moving container plants indoors. With the right preparation, Bridal bouquet will withstand seasonal changes and continue to thrive.
